A Magical Evening: Lea Salonga In Toronto

Filipino powerhouse Lea Salonga in Toronto. A renowned singer, actress, and producer, brought her Stage, Screen & Everything in Between tour to Toronto’s Great Canadian Casino on October 18, 2025. The concert took the audience on a magical journey through her illustrious career, featuring songs from her Broadway days to her iconic Disney roles and taking pride in her overall achievements and accolades, which inspired and influenced many and exemplified the ultimate dream of an international performer.

With no scheduled opener, the night began, accompanied by two keys, a drummer, two strings, two backup vocals, and her musical director, Larry Yurman, on the piano, as they got in position, Larry signalled the upbeat to cue in the band. The curtains then unveiled the board, welcoming the audience with a huge text visual: “Lea Salonga Stage, Screen & Everything in Between.” Lea graced the stage shortly after, waving and smiling as everyone excitedly screamed. From the moment she began her performance, it was clear that she could command and captivate the crowd. Building up the crowd’s energy, she also performed lively renditions of “Stayin’ Alive” by the Bee Gees, “(Everything I do) I Do It For You” by Bryan Adams, and “My Heart Will Go On” by Celine Dion, as she yelled out “I love you, Celine” to the Canadian crowd.

Transitioning to the next part of her set, Lea reflected on her gratitude for the initial opportunities she had earlier in her career. Earlier than that, she was in the midst of her bachelor’s degree to become a doctor when, suddenly, a 20-minute audition changed her life. A pivotal moment for her. It allowed her to shine in some of Broadway’s biggest productions. To recreate and relive those experiences, her backup singers, Sarah Galbraith and Andrew Kotzen, joined her in the middle of the stage and performed numerous duets, showcasing her vocal prowess.

Returning to the theme of “Stage,” she selected songs from Stephen Sondheim’s catalog, including a performance of “Being Alive” from the musical Company, manifesting and expressing her desire to be cast in a future production.

Next, she teased the Disney segment of her show, mentioning her roles as the singing voice of various Disney princesses, which excited the crowd, who erupted. She responded playfully, “Good things come to those who wait,” and sang some of her favorite Disney songs, like Part of Your World, A Dream Is a Wish Your Heart Makes, Colors of the Wind, and Let It Go. Too captivated, the audience forgot their anticipation for her actual Disney songs.

Lea proudly acknowledged her heritage by asking how many in the audience were Filipino and jokingly wondered if she should be concerned about the overwhelming number of nurses in Ontario present that night. She then performed “Kailangan Kita,” which translates to “I Need You,” a song written by fellow Filipino singer-actor Ogie Alcasid. Though sung in a different language, her emotional delivery resonated deeply with everyone in attendance.

As the concert neared its conclusion, Lea addressed her preference between the two princesses she voiced. Choosing Mulan over Jasmine, she delighted the audience with “Reflection,” followed by a duet of “A Whole New World” with Andrew Kotzen. Hearing those songs live felt surreal, transporting attendees to the memories of watching “Mulan” and “Aladdin.”

In Closing

No Lea Salonga concert would be complete without “On My Own,” one of her most recognized and beloved songs that catapulted her international career. As the night drew to a close, she exited the stage while the band played “Golden” from the Netflix movie “KPop Demon Hunters. “She returned for an encore featuring a love-themed medley and capped off the night with “Over the Rainbow. “She took her final bow and left everyone with a memorable musical experience of a lifetime.
